awesome thread, read from start to finish just now. given me lots of ideas for my k11 engine wise am i correct in thinking that if i too find a rover zs manifold, and chop it up a bit it will fit, provided i leave a screw hole for the lambda sensor, it would still run fine without a CAT? as I'm going to leave injection on for peace of mind and consumption figures, provided this would still work. got a bike can to go on mine that will fit perfectly too so might aswell make a whole new exhaust system for it while I'm at it and make a manifold fit cheers
|
|
|
|
|
|
Sept 5, 2011 13:07:01 GMT
|
Yea mate will work perfect with lambda and no cat.
The inner runners can be tweaked in with a vice but I recommend cutting the outer runners and rewelding at different angle. The most time consuming part wad the flange
